Winter Wonderland in Sikkim: 7-Day Itinerary

Viewed by 109 travelers

Experience the enchanting beauty of Sikkim Gangtok in winter with this 7-day itinerary. Embrace the snow-covered landscapes, explore popular attractions, and discover hidden gems in this Himalayan paradise.

Monday, December 25: Arrival in Gangtok

Welcome to Gangtok! After arriving at Bagdogra Airport, take a picturesque drive to Gangtok. Spend the morning exploring local markets like MG Marg, where you can indulge in shopping and taste traditional delicacies. In the afternoon, visit the Namgyal Institute of Tibetology to learn about Tibetan Buddhist culture and art. Wrap up your day with a serene visit to Enchey Monastery, offering panoramic views of the city.

  • MG Marg: Free, 2 hours
  • Namgyal Institute of Tibetology: INR 20 per person, 1 hour
  • Enchey Monastery: Free, 1 hour
Tuesday, December 26: Tsomgo Lake and Baba Mandir

Embark on a memorable excursion to Tsomgo Lake, shimmering amidst the snow-capped mountains. Marvel at the frozen beauty of the lake and enjoy yak rides. Continue your journey to Baba Mandir, a revered shrine dedicated to an Indian army soldier. Experience the serenity of the snow-clad surroundings and gain insight into the soldier's heroic tales.

  • Tsomgo Lake: INR 100 per person for permit, INR 400 for yak ride, 4 hours
  • Baba Mandir: Free, 2 hours
Wednesday, December 27: Rumtek Monastery and Banjhakri Falls

Start your day with a visit to Rumtek Monastery, one of the largest and most significant monasteries in Sikkim. Admire the intricate architecture and immerse yourself in the spiritual ambiance. In the afternoon, head to Banjhakri Falls, surrounded by lush greenery and captivating snow-covered landscapes. Enjoy the tranquility of the cascading waterfalls and explore the adjoining park.

  • Rumtek Monastery: Free, 2 hours
  • Banjhakri Falls: Free, 1 hour
Thursday, December 28: Ganesh Tok, Hanuman Tok, and Tashi Viewpoint

Experience breathtaking panoramic views of Gangtok from the hilltops. Begin your day by visiting Ganesh Tok, a small temple dedicated to Lord Ganesh. Enjoy the stunning vistas and offer prayers. Next, head to Hanuman Tok, another tem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man. Finally, visit Tashi Viewpoint, where you can catch a mesmerizing sunrise or sunset amidst snow-capped peaks.

  • Ganesh Tok: Free, 30 minutes
  • Hanuman Tok: Free, 1 hour
  • Tashi Viewpoint: Free, 1 hour
Friday, December 29: Yumthang Valley and Zero Point

Embark on an unforgettable journey to Yumthang Valley, also known as the Valley of Flowers. Admire the surreal beauty of the snow-clad valley and the meandering Yumthang Chu River. If weather permits, continue your adventure to Zero Point, the highest altitude that can be reached by road in the region. Witness the breathtaking landscapes and immerse yourself in the snow-covered paradise.

  • Yumthang Valley: INR 150 per person for permit, 6 hours
  • Zero Point: INR 300 per person for permit, 3 hours
Saturday, December 30: Nathula Pass and Old Silk Route

Embark on a thrilling journey to Nathula Pass, located at an altitude of 14,140 feet. Marvel at the snow-covered pass, which connects India and Tibet. Note that road conditions and the opening of the pass are subject to weather conditions, so plan accordingly. While returning, explore the charm of the Old Silk Route, dotted with scenic landscapes and quaint villages.

  • Nathula Pass: INR 200 per person for permit, 6 hours
  • Old Silk Route: Free, 4 hours
Sunday, December 31: Local Exploration and New Year Celebrations

Spend your last day in Gangtok exploring local attractions based on your preferences. You can visit the Flower Exhibition Centre, Do-Drul Chorten Stupa, or take a leisurely walk amidst the beautiful Rhododendron sanctuary. In the evening, join the New Year festivities in MG Marg, where you can enjoy live music, dance, and a vibrant atmosphere.

  • Flower Exhibition Centre: INR 20 per person, 1 hour
  • Do-Drul Chorten Stupa: Free, 1 hour
  • Rhododendron Sanctuary: Free, 2 hours
  • New Year Celebrations: Free
Monday, January 1: Departure from Gangtok

It's time to bid farewell to the magical land of Gangtok. Depart from Bagdogra Airport with unforgettable memories of the snow-covered paradise.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path experiences, consider visiting the serene Seven Sisters Waterfalls, taking a cable car ride to see the breathtaking view from Ganesh Tok viewpoint, or exploring the tranquil Phensong Monastery. Don't miss trying local delicacies like momos, thukpa, and gundruk soup, which will satisfy your taste buds and enrich your culinary journey in Sikkim.
